Solve the following simultaneous equations : 5m - 3n = 19; m - 6 = -7​

Respuesta :

Kaaira32 Kaaira32
  • 08-07-2021

Answer:

m = -1

n= -8

Step-by-step explanation:

5m -3n = 19

m - 6 = -7

solve for m:

m = -7+6

m = -1

plug in m

5(-1) - 3n = 19

-5 - 3n = 19

-3n = 24

n = -8
